I received the following error:
ERROR 2002 (HY000): Can’t connect to local MySQL server through socket ‘/var/run/mysqld/mysqld.sock’ (111)
So after restarting the server and trying to figure out what was going on I tried reinstalling mysql with this: apt-get install mysql-server
Then I restarted apache and still keep getting the same error message.
What could be causing this? Can anyone point me in the right direction to trouble shoot this issue?

I have a new droplet and experienced this both times I shut it down. I just tried entering the console and inputting sudo service mysql restart. For me, this worked immediately.
